Sign in Pushing the button on the active card will move it to the other deck and then make it active. Sign up for a free GitHub account to open an issue and contact its maintainers and the community. The initial slide shouldn't be changed when you are using that slider.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. Not the answer you're looking for? Looking for job perks? Using an Ohm Meter to test for bonding of a subpanel. You should import directly from Swiper package which supports css, scss and less, Navigation, Pagination, Pagination / Dynamic Bullets, Progress Pagination, Fraction Pagination, Custom Pagination, Scrollbar, Vertical slider, Space Between Slides, Mutiple Slides Per View, Auto Slides Per View / Carousel Mode, Centered Slides, Centered Slides + Auto Slides Per View, Free Mode / No Fixed Positions, Scroll Container, Multiple Row Slides Layout, Nested Swipers, Grab Cursor, Loop Mode / Infinite Loop, Loop Mode With Multiple Slides Per Group, Fade Effect, 3D Cube Effect, 3D Coverflow Effect, 3D Flip Effect, Mousewheel-control, Auto Play, Thumbs Gallery With Two-way Control, RTL Layout, Parallax, Lazyload Image, Responsive Breakpoints, Manipulating component outside Swiper, Customized Component. What woodwind & brass instruments are most air efficient? Making statements based on opinion; back them up with references or personal experience. Here is the list of additional modules imports: Virtual - Virtual Slides module. I have tried to handle the onSwiper function with props but still cant update the slide index. You signed in with another tab or window. If I remove the fixed-width CSS class it breaks the Swiper coverflow effect. Nefro Care Solutions se une a la prevencin y tomamos todas las medidas necesarias para cuidarte a ti y al personal mdico. setTimeout({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, How to change the Swiper height or slide width in React JS without using fixed CSS, https://thoughtbot.com/blog/transitions-and-transforms.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. What does the power set mean in the construction of Von Neumann universe? How to convert a string to number in TypeScript? How is white allowed to castle 0-0-0 in this position? Weve imported the Carousel component from react-responsive-carousel and used it to display our responsive json object. In this case we need to use direct file imports: As you see it is really easy to integrate Swiper into your website or app. See also the list of contributors who participated in this project. Thanks for contributing an answer to Stack Overflow! Are you sure you want to create this branch? : Swiper React component receive all Swiper parameters as component props, plus some extra props: Also it supports all Swiper events in on{Eventname} format. Can I use my Coinbase address to receive bitcoin? On whose turn does the fright from a terror dive end? Esperamos verte pronto en lnea! The newer option is to set initialSlide={specificIndex} on instance. You can find some information here #85. ReactJS and Typescript : refers to a value, but is being used as a type here (TS2749), enjoy another stunning sunset 'over' a glass of assyrtiko, Adding EV Charger (100A) in secondary panel (100A) fed off main (200A). I use very-ugly hook for duplicate the logic of interactions with a direct processing a DOM instead of doing it with React. Interpreting non-statistically significant results: Do we have "no evidence" or "insufficient evidence" to reject the null? This is an excellent carousels component with a robust amount of options and configurations. The Swiper component takes onSwiper props a function that will return you an instance of the created Swiper.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Adems, podremos ajustar tu tratamiento de dilisis segn tus necesidades y monitorear tu salud de cerca para garantizar tu bienestar. We wanted to share the impact image weight can have on your carbon emissions. Learn more about this carousel here. Asking for help, clarification, or responding to other answers. react id swiper slideto. Each slide should be wrapped by HTML element. Using an Ohm Meter to test for bonding of a subpanel. I am using Swiper library to show image Slides and thumbnails. I am trying to use Swiperjs in my project, in a Typescript file. A good understanding of Next.js, but its not strictly required. Effect of a "bad grade" in grad school applications. Well occasionally send you account related emails.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. I use very-ugly hook for duplicate the logic of interactions with a direct processing a DOM instead of doing it with React. Do you see any way to proceed to be able to change the active slide (without using pagination from Swiper) outside Swiper component in my .tsx file? (exclamation mark / bang) operator when dereferencing a member? You can use swiper instance to access swiper API (https://swiperjs.com/api/) Elastic Carousel is a flexible and responsive carousel component; it somehow does not support automatic cycling through content but has full support for RTL(right to left) rendering and animations. Basic knowledge of CSS, Javascript, and React.js. 565), Improving the copy in the close modal and post notices - 2023 edition, New blog post from our CEO Prashanth: Community is the future of AI. However this approach has no easing or transition like other interactions so it feels too abrupt. Can you force a React component to rerender without calling setState? What is Swiper? However, I don't think this is a good solution to the problem. How about saving the world? If you combine this with a CSS transition you can achieve the effect you mentioned. Swiper - is the free and most modern mobile touch slider with hardware accelerated transitions and amazing native behavior. The width on this class is set to a fixed size which drives how the rest of the Swiper is rendered. and there is method slideTo. My phone's touchscreen is damaged. Have a question about this project? You signed in with another tab or window. Here is one of the implementation options: Thanks for contributing an answer to Stack Overflow! I found that also setting the height property will help it reset after a resize, but I have to set the fixed width CSS. How can I center items (fixed-width - swiper-slide) properly? How about saving the world? swiper.loopCreate();}, 1000); the loop doesnt work properly on slide update so manually updating it! En Consulta Renal, estamos aqu para apoyarte en tu camino hacia una vida ms saludable. Follow the prompts to complete the process, then navigate into the application directory and start the dev server with the following: cd next-carousels // to navigate into the project directory npm run dev . You should import directly from Swiper package which supports css, scss and less. directiveRef.update or swiper.update() Designed mostly for iOS, but also works great on latest Android, Windows Phone 8 and modern Desktop browsers. There are 168 other projects in the npm registry using react-id-swiper. You can save this instance to a state and then call all the methods you need on it. How can this same interaction be achieved with the API or without manipulating the CSS class? Learn how to use CSS Modules or see other Next.js built-in CSS support here. Tanzsportclub (TSC) Pocking e.V. A library to use idangerous Swiper as a ReactJs component which allows Swiper's modules custom build, A library to use Swiper as a ReactJs component. Connect and share knowledge within a single location that is structured and easy to search. Slide #2 rev2023.4.21.43403. Embedded hyperlinks in a thesis or research paper. Making transformative visuals experiences at global scale possible On what basis are pardoning decisions made by presidents or governors when exercising their pardoning power? Connect and share knowledge within a single location that is structured and easy to search. Already on GitHub? Why in the Sierpiski Triangle is this set being used as the example for the OSC and not a more "natural"? How about saving the world? this sets an INITIAL slide but then it does not change depending on state/index changes. Why can't the change in a crystal structure be due to the rotation of octahedra? If you want to use Swiper custom build to reduce bundle size, you need to use extra props below. : For SCSS styles replace css with scss in imports paths, e.g. How a top-ranked engineering school reimagined CS curriculum (Ep. So ideally I'd rather like to have something like : But actually, Typescript claims that: Only a void function can be called with the 'new' keyword and I do not know how to handle that. Swiper React is available only via NPM as a part of the main Swiper library: swiper/react exports 2 components: Swiper and SwiperSlide: Swiper package contains different sets of CSS, Less and SCSS styles: Modules styles (not required if you already imported bundle styles): For Less styles replace css with less in imports paths, e.g. If you want to use Swiper custom build to reduce bundle size, you need to use extra props below.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Swiper React cannot convert undefined or null to object. Iste quos mollitia sed quod consectetur at quam dolore praesentium neque eos assumenda iusto nam laborum laboriosam odio blanditiis possimus accusantium recusandae porro exercitationem itaque", "https://res.cloudinary.com/kizmelvin/image/upload/w_1000,c_fill,ar_1:1,g_auto,r_max,bo_5px_solid_red,b_rgb:262c35/v1597364662/kizmelvin/ussama-azam-hlg-ltdCoI0-unsplash_ttfjib.jpg", "https://res.cloudinary.com/kizmelvin/image/upload/w_1000,c_fill,ar_1:1,g_auto,r_max,bo_5px_solid_red,b_rgb:262c35/v1645530199/kizmelvin/Carousel%20assets/slim-emcee-jzdOX0XkXr8-unsplash_zocsdq.jpg", "https://res.cloudinary.com/kizmelvin/image/upload/w_1000,c_fill,ar_1:1,g_auto,r_max,bo_5px_solid_red,b_rgb:262c35/v1645534321/kizmelvin/Carousel%20assets/luwadlin-bosman-J1oObe7WWjk-unsplash_f56oh3.jpg", "react-responsive-carousel/lib/styles/carousel.min.css", View the Image and Video Technology Platform , Animating Next.js Images With Framer Motion, Add Cloudinary to Your Existing Stack with Composable Architecture, Adding Netflix-style video overlays Transitions with NuxtJS, Happy Earth Day: How to Deliver Sustainable Video and Imagery. Did the Golden Gate Bridge 'flatten' under the weight of 300,000 people in 1987? Swiper is not compatible with all platforms, it is a modern touch slider which is focused only on modern apps/platforms to bring the best experience and simplicity. I can swipe directly in the Swiper component but I'd like to make that possible otherwise and elsewhere as well. Checks and balances in a 3 branch market economy. Next, in the carousels folder, lets create an Elastic.js file and build the carousel. A tag already exists with the provided branch name. swiper/react. How do you explicitly set a new property on `window` in TypeScript? Then in the browser, we should now see the three different carousels with different options and customizations. Not the answer you're looking for? In pages/index.js, well import the ElasticCarousel component and render it right after the BootstrapCarousel element. Click to share on Twitter (Opens in new window), Click to share on Facebook (Opens in new window), Click to share on LinkedIn (Opens in new window), Click to share on Reddit (Opens in new window), Click to share on Tumblr (Opens in new window), Click to share on Pinterest (Opens in new window), Click to share on Telegram (Opens in new window), Click to share on WhatsApp (Opens in new window). I found nolimits4web/swiper#2629 in wrapped lib and I have used loopDestroy() and loopCreate() to fix it. What differentiates living as mere roommates from living in a marriage-like relationship? In my particular use case, I was able to move this slide and fix the problem, so as long as the slide I'm trying to update isn't the first slide this behavior doesn't seem to pop up. Asking for help, clarification, or responding to other answers. before adding a slider destroy the loop Would you ever say "eat pig" instead of "eat pork"? I tried using onSwiper prop to achieve this functionality but i ran into an error. Looking for job perks? When i console.log(swiper) it is returning null. hmm this fix worked for me This is actually so easy. Visit the documentation for more carousel configurations and customizations. I found it: import SwiperCore from 'swiper'; Swiperjs in React : swiper.slideTo TypeScript. I can't seem to find anything wrong with my code as per the documentation. Keyboard - Keyboard Control module. You can use useSwiper to get the swiper instance inside Swiper on React, and then freely control behaviors of the Swiper including using slideTo method.
Do Insurance Companies Look At Street Cameras, Articles R